Residential rehabilitation rehab for brief explains a drug and/or alcohol treatment programme that is provided in a residential setting. Rehabilitations are normally abstinence-based and supply an extreme program of assistance and care focused on individuals who have problem becoming drug complimentary in the community. They are provided as either standard rehabilitation designs or newer, more locally-based models: Standard designs of rehab frequently involve the individual having a complete break from their existing scenarios and staying at a centre that is far from their house and drug-using environment Newer models of property treatment are emerging across the nation, that include supported real estate provision connected to structured treatment and other regional http://lukastrij212.iamarrows.com/more-about-how-many-addiction-rehab-centers-are-in-warrenton services.

Although this is not universally the case, 'phases' of rehab are broadly mapped as follows: Phase 1: Very first phase typically corresponds to short-stay corrective programmes or the preliminary phases (as much as 12 weeks) of long-stay rehabilitative programs, concentrating on extensive therapeutic interventions and the immediate responses to becoming drug totally free Stage 2: 2nd stage normally corresponds to the later phases (more than 12 weeks) of long-stay rehabilitative programs, focusing on the advancement of life abilities, reintegration through education, training or employment-focused needs; the abilities needed to sustain a drug-free way of life while still getting intensive assistance from the program Phase 3: Third phase is used by some organisations and normally represents independent living and supported real estate with some Addiction Treatment Center assistance and mentoring maintained with the primary rehabilitation.

Not all residents then need or request extra phases, however, where they do, funding for the next stage may require to be agreed (see listed below for funding arrangements). There are 6 primary philosophies or approaches offered by conventional model rehabs. These philosophies greatly influence how the programme is run, although increasingly services combine various components of the philosophies to fulfill individual client requirements. In identifying the appropriate service, it is very important to match a client's understanding of their drug and/or alcohol abuse to the rehabilitation's approach to treatment and specific philosophy: This is an increasingly broad term originating from the 12 actions of the Minnesota Design and is connected with the Go to the website techniques of Narcotics/Alcoholics Anonymous (NA/AA).

The model is increasingly being modified and adapted to enable higher flexibility and specific care planning, and services may refer to their programs as customized 12-Step or modified Minnesota design. Locals will typically invest time in "action" groups, in addition to other private and group restorative activities. Although the domestic aspect of 12-Step programmes may last 3 months or less, ex-residents will be expected to continue to go to NA/AA group meetings in the community. In a restorative community, staff and clients take part together as members of a social and discovering neighborhood. The service may have a hierarchical structure which locals overcome and in which each stage has a various pattern of activity, together with growing flexibility and obligations.

Like 12-Step programmes, healing neighborhood designs have actually been adapted over the years and made shorter and more versatile. The extensive nature of their approach to specific psychology still suggests that they tend to be amongst the longer programmes (6 12 months) Faith-based services have spiritual staff and may or may not require locals to share their faith or participate in faith-related activities. These activities will consist of; time studying spiritual texts and the lessons to be discovered from them, in conversation and in prayer (what is inpatient drug rehab). These are programmes which do not comply with a particular approach and use a variety of various approaches and interventions focused on meeting the needs of specific locals.
